Origins of the Surname Klimentyev

The surname Klimentyev is derived from the given name Kliment, which is of Greek origin and means "gentle" or "meek." The suffix "-yev" is a common Russian patronymic ending, indicating "son of." Therefore, Klimentyev can be interpreted as "son of Kliment."

The name Kliment has a long history and has been popular in Eastern Europe and Russia for centuries. It is believed to have been introduced to these regions by early Christian missionaries and saints, who spread the name and its associated virtues.

Distribution of the Surname Klimentyev

Russia

With an incidence rate of 278, Russia is the country with the highest prevalence of the surname Klimentyev. This is not surprising, given the name's Russian origins and popularity in the region. Klimentyevs in Russia can be found across the country, with concentrations in major cities such as Moscow and Saint Petersburg.

Belarus

In Belarus, the surname Klimentyev is less common but still present, with an incidence rate of 73.
